Vooks: NiGHTS: Journey of Dreams Review

Overall, NiGHTS: Journey of Dreams is a good game that should appeal to all ages. It is simple enough for casual gamers to pick up easily and has enough nostalgia value to distract the hardcore crowds. Even if a little short, the game's two player options and online racing add some lasting appeal to the package making for a game that will occupy even the most attentive players for at least a few weeks.
